In the XC2 class, Brycen Neal earned his fifth win of the season. Neal put on an impressive ride and led the class from lap two until the checkers.  Aside from another class win, Neal earned his best overall finish to date by taking seventh overall.

Landon Wolfe showed that even a damaged foot can’t stop him. Wolfe missed round six after sustaining an injury at a local race to his Achilles heel. He grabbed the early lead in the XC2 class and dropped to second on lap two. He rode in second, uncontested, until the checkers flew on lap five.  Wolfe is currently ranked third in the XC2 points. Fred Marley earned third to take his third podium of the season. Marley is currently fourth in XC2 points.

It was a very close race and went down to the wire for top Top Amateur honors as College A (16-21) racers Marshal Goings and Jay Shadron battled to the checkers. Goings came out on top and bested Shadron by a slim 00:00.165. Goings’ impressive race earned him the class win, Top Amateur and ninth overall. Shadron rounded out the top ten overall.

The morning race brought Schoolboy racer, Westley Wolfe, to the center of the podium for his second overall win. Wofle won the morning overall by an impressive 2:18. Wolfe is currently ranked second in the Schoolboy class. Rob Smith put his Can-Am Renegade into the second podium spot.  The U2 racer earned his third class win this year and third overall podium. Smith is currently leading the U2 Class. Kylie Ahart kept her perfect season alive with her seventh win in a row. The Women’s class leader also earned her first overall podium of the season. Ahart came in third overall, less than one minute behind Smith.

In just two weeks the top off road racers will be back at it in Masontown, West Virginia at the Parts Unlimited Mountaineer Run GNCC. The race is close to home for many top pros including West Virginia’s Adam McGill and Pennsylvania’s Chris Bithell. There is no doubt that they will each be vying for their first win in front of their hometown crowd, while Chris Borich will seek to continue his domination of the 2013 season.
